Factors to Consider When Choosing Combination Wall Ovens With Microwave

When choosing a combination wall oven with microwave, you need to take into account how well it fits in your space, including specific measurements and clearance requirements. Think about the different cooking modes and features that match your cooking habits, from convection baking to microwave reheating, and make sure the installation process aligns with your home’s wiring and safety standards. finally, evaluate energy efficiency ratings and control options to find a model that’s both safe, cost-effective, and easy to operate for your household.

Space and Dimensions Compatibility

Choosing a combo wall oven with a microwave needs careful planning. First, measure your kitchen space. Check the height, width, and depth of the area where you want to put the oven. Make sure the whole unit will fit. Look at the size the manufacturer says you need for the cutout in the cabinet. This helps the oven fit well without gaps or force.

Think about how much space is inside the oven. If you cook big meals or several dishes at once, get one with a capacity of 2 to 4 cubic feet. Also, look at your kitchen layout. Make sure the oven won’t block doors, drawers, or other fixtures.

Leave some space around the oven for air flow. Good air flow helps keep the oven cool and working well. This is especially important if you have a small space. By following these steps, you can pick an oven that fits your kitchen and works well for your cooking needs.

Installation and Wiring Needs

Installing and wiring your combination wall oven with microwave correctly is very important. First, check that your cabinets and the space cutout match the oven’s size. Make sure the measurements are exact so the oven fits well and gets enough air flow. Many ovens need their own electrical circuit. Usually, this means a 30-amp or bigger breaker to supply enough power safely. If you are putting in a built-in oven, you might need to make the opening bigger or add mounting brackets. These help keep the oven steady and ensure proper air flow around it. Always follow the instructions that come with the oven. Pay close attention to wiring, grounding, and breaker size. Wrong wiring can cause safety problems or damage the oven. Read the installation manual fully before starting. Making sure the wiring is correct will keep your oven safe to use and help it last longer.

Safety and Control Features

When choosing a combination wall oven with a microwave, safety features are very important. Look for models that have child locks, auto shut-off, and control lockout options. These help prevent accidents and keep everyone safe. Make sure the controls are easy to use, like touch screens or dials, so you can set the right temperature and cooking modes easily. Visible indicator lights are helpful. They show when the oven or microwave is on or finished, so you avoid burns or surprises.

Safety glass doors also matter. Choose doors that are made of tempered or multi-layered glass. These are less likely to break or cause burns. Also, check if the oven has safety alarms. These alarms warn you if the temperature gets too high, if something isn’t working right, or if the door isn’t fully closed. These signals help you ensure everything is safe while cooking.
